#include "decalEffect.h"
#include "bamReader.h"
#include "bamWriter.h"
#include "datagram.h"
#include "datagramIterator.h"
TypeHandle DecalEffect::_type_handle;
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::make
// Access: Published, Static
// Description: Constructs a new DecalEffect object.
////////////////////////////////////////////////////////////////////
CPT(RenderEffect) DecalEffect::
make() {
DecalEffect *effect = new DecalEffect;
return return_new(effect);
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::safe_to_combine
// Access: Public, Virtual
// Description: Returns true if this kind of effect can safely be
// combined with sibling nodes that share the exact same
// effect, or false if this is not a good idea.
////////////////////////////////////////////////////////////////////
bool DecalEffect::
safe_to_combine() const {
return false;
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::compare_to_impl
// Access: Protected, Virtual
// Description: Intended to be overridden by derived DecalEffect
// types to return a unique number indicating whether
// this DecalEffect is equivalent to the other one.
//
// This should return 0 if the two DecalEffect objects
// are equivalent, a number less than zero if this one
// should be sorted before the other one, and a number
// greater than zero otherwise.
//
// This will only be called with two DecalEffect
// objects whose get_type() functions return the same.
////////////////////////////////////////////////////////////////////
int DecalEffect::
compare_to_impl(const RenderEffect *other) const {
// All DecalEffects are equivalent--there are no properties to
// store.
return 0;
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::register_with_read_factory
// Access: Public, Static
// Description: Tells the BamReader how to create objects of type
// DecalEffect.
////////////////////////////////////////////////////////////////////
void DecalEffect::
register_with_read_factory() {
BamReader::get_factory()->register_factory(get_class_type(), make_from_bam);
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::write_datagram
// Access: Public, Virtual
// Description: Writes the contents of this object to the datagram
// for shipping out to a Bam file.
////////////////////////////////////////////////////////////////////
void DecalEffect::
write_datagram(BamWriter *manager, Datagram &dg) {
RenderEffect::write_datagram(manager, dg);
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::make_from_bam
// Access: Protected, Static
// Description: This function is called by the BamReader's factory
// when a new object of type DecalEffect is encountered
// in the Bam file. It should create the DecalEffect
// and extract its information from the file.
////////////////////////////////////////////////////////////////////
TypedWritable *DecalEffect::
make_from_bam(const FactoryParams &params) {
DecalEffect *effect = new DecalEffect;
DatagramIterator scan;
BamReader *manager;
parse_params(params, scan, manager);
effect->fillin(scan, manager);
return effect;
}
////////////////////////////////////////////////////////////////////
// Function: DecalEffect::fillin
// Access: Protected
// Description: This internal function is called by make_from_bam to
// read in all of the relevant data from the BamFile for
// the new DecalEffect.
////////////////////////////////////////////////////////////////////
void DecalEffect::
fillin(DatagramIterator &scan, BamReader *manager) {
RenderEffect::fillin(scan, manager);
}
